Gold, Ben K. – 1972
This investigation was conducted to identify trends in evening enrollment patterns among the California community colleges outside the Los Angeles District, and to identify causes for those trends. Seventy-four college presidents (87% of those contacted) responded to the questionnaire. Enrollment statistics are presented by year from 1966 to 1971…

Pennsylvania State Univ., University Park. – 1970
Designed to help secondary school districts plan continuing education activities and to define possible areas of program coordination between districts, this 1970 inventory of continuing education activities represents responses from 353 (59.6%) of the secondary school districts in Pennsylvania. It indicates the number of courses (a total of 503)…

LORING, ROSALIND KOLAN – 1966
TO DISCOVER TRENDS AND INNOVATIONS IN SPECIAL PROGRAMS FOR MATURE WOMEN OFFERED BY UNIVERSITY EXTENSION DIVISIONS AND EVENING COLLEGES, QUESTIONNAIRES WERE SENT TO 216 INSTITUTIONS (157 RESPONDED) AND AN INTERVIEW SCHEDULE WAS USED IN PERSONAL VISITS TO FIVE INSTITUTIONS. OF THE 157 SCHOOLS, 93 SCHEDULED PROGRAMS FOR ADULT WOMEN RANGING FROM…

Alderman, L. R. – Bureau of Education, Department of the Interior, 1927
For the purpose of this report, adult education is assumed to have the following characteristics: (1) It is carried on voluntarily and during the leisure time of a mature individual; and (2) The study is seriously undertaken and is pursued under guidance. During the past biennium there has been much activity in the field of adult education. The…
